Mouse freezing and screen flashing in Ubuntu's Gnome 42 Wayland, on Raspberry Pi #167

Closed videosmith closed 1 year ago

videosmith commented 1 year ago

Bug Description When 'Disable background transparency' is selected, mouse intermittantly freezes and screen flashes. When deselected, issues apparently disappear.

Expected behavior Should perform the same under either selection

Cuperino commented 1 year ago

Marking as unconfirmed because of the flashes. The mouse freezes, which are confirmed, are an issue with either Gnome Shell or Gnome Mutter. Most likely Shell.

Cuperino commented 1 year ago

For Wayland support in Plasma, sudo apt install plasma-workspace-wayland

videosmith commented 1 year ago

Switched to kde plasma-wayland, mouse freezes and flashes issue apparently resolved in this configuration.

Cuperino commented 1 year ago

It's unfortunate but not all environments can do high performance graphics well. KDE might be one of the best for these purposes, since it is used for the SteamDeck (not to be confused with the StreamDeck). But fortunately Gnome and Canonical are focused in improving performance for games, which will also help in this regard.
